Site‐determined functionalization of large RNA molecules can be achieved by a strategy involving twin ribozymes and small synthetic oligonucleotides. The twin ribozyme mediates the exchange of a predefined patch of RNA sequence against a modified oligonucleotide to result in specific functionalization of the large RNA.
